Dave from Hase Creative got in touch with us, needing an audio solution for a 360 shoot with multiple talent around Queen Victoria Market. The challenge was having only the morning to rig the market and our base being in Brick Lane - hundreds of metres away from where the shoot was taking place and not within visual line of sight. This meant we required not only a way to wirelessly capture clean dialogue audio but also send a clean wireless audio feed for our director, dp, the client and other key stakeholders to monitor what was being said on the fly in a tight timeframe.
The solution, and huge shout out to the talented Adam Morgan for helping us with this setup. We used 2 x Tentacle Sync Track E Recorders, DPA 4061 Core Lapel Microphones, DPA 4099 Core Minature Shotgun Microphones and at the centre of the setup, the Apple iPhone 15 Pro for monitoring. The DPA Core 4061 was hidden on the talent, plugged into a splitter to record broadcast quality 24 bit audio, then split to an iPhone so we could live monitor, which allowed everyone else to dial in and hear the audio from the talent on the go with zero latency.
